Output 53bf6626fc883979893891d0705fad40bf96035d4423a484a88fb54df965e874:1

value
56000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 86ad611f4f836b18a9fabb746cfd5c949b1a1652 OP_EQUAL
address
3Dy8ArphLUf1E4agZHhFnb4nEGmXs7XV7V
transaction
53bf6626fc883979893891d0705fad40bf96035d4423a484a88fb54df965e874
spent
true